Quick and Effective Fixes
Here are a few of the most common issues that occur with garbage disposals and how you can resolve the issues yourself.
- Jams – Jams are by far the most common issue homeowners find themselves faced with when it comes to their garbage disposals. When a disposal jam occurs, start by turning the switch on to confirm that there is a humming sound present rather than the typical grinding sound of your disposal. This humming noise typically indicates that there is something caught between the shredding ring and the impellers. To resolve this issue, you can use an offset wrench. Insert it into the bottom of the garbage disposal, turn it clockwise and then counter clockwise. This should loosen the jam and start the disposal up again.
- Regular Clogs – Clogs are very common garbage disposal issues in nearly every household. The quickest and most effective way to resolve your ongoing clogging issue is by being cautious about what you are putting down your garbage disposal. You should never toss oil, grease, corn husks, egg shells, banana peels and other large chunks of food into the disposal since they are sure to cause a clog. If you find that your disposal is continuously clogging it may be time to have it professionally cleaned along with the adjacent sink.
- Ongoing Leaks – Another very common problem with disposals is that of leaking. When a leak occurs, be certain to shut down your disposal before attempting to repair it. The culprit of nearly all disposal leaks is that of the top flange on the disposal. Tightening the flange can solve the leak and, in some cases, replacing the flange altogether may be necessary.
- Won’t Start – No Power – If your garbage disposal is without power or will simply not turn on, we highly recommend you start by ensuring that the appliance is properly plugged in. Next, you want to check your home’s circuit breaker. If both appear to be intact, it may very well be that your switch or even the disposal itself is either faulty or has been damaged.
